Background:
http://mail-archives.apache.org/mod_mbox/maven-dev/201104.mbox/%[email protected]%3E
{{--also-make}} (with {{--projects}}) is useful, but suffers from the problem
that dependent projects are always built to the same goal/phase as the selected
project(s). That is fine for e.g. {{compile}} or {{install}}, but not for e.g.
{{test}} where you would only want to build {{compile}} (or {{test-compile}})
for dependencies, not actually test them.
Suggest a variant form of this parameter (say {{--also-make-phase}} / {{-amp}})
which would accept a goal or phase to run on dependencies in place of the
regular arguments. For example, to run a unit test after making sure all its
dependencies have been (re-)compiled:
{noformat}
mvn -amp test-compile -pl testedmod test -Dtest=OneTest
{noformat}
or to run an (unpacked) web application after (re-)compiling libraries it uses:
{noformat}
mvn -amp compile -pl webapp jetty:run
{noformat}
You might want to pass a goal rather than a phase, so the name could be
misleading, but I think that would be a rarer use case. Ditto passing multiple
goals/phases for the upstream projects.
